### Watchdog restart — KioskOne

The KioskOne watchdog polls each kiosk's heartbeat endpoint every 30 seconds and force-restarts the app after three misses. If kiosks across a whole site go dark, check the Braylen site gateway first — the watchdog will otherwise cycle every unit needlessly. To pause the watchdog during planned maintenance, call the suppress endpoint on the fleet controller, which authenticates with the service key shown below.

app token of tadug-yahag = vxb3-949

Ticket: Staging env misconfigured for Siftgate bloom filter

The bloom layer in front of the Pellet KV store is rejecting all lookups in staging because the env file was copied from the dev template without credentials. False-positive tuning values are fine; only the auth line is missing. To unblock the weekly demo, the Pellet admission secret must be set on the following line.

env line for yaguf-fajop: LEDGER_TOKEN13=fb08984397349

GET /v2/drift returns per-sensor drift coefficients for all humidity and temperature probes registered to a GrowCell controller. The correction model recalibrates hourly against the reference probe; values outside ±0.8% trigger a `drift_alert` flag in the response body. Reviewers: note that stale coefficients are served with `cached: true` rather than a 5xx, so clients must check that field. Requests must authenticate against the internal CalibHub service using the key below.

app token of kajop-tahag = qvz23-qaEp6MzrfP2AwhVbZwsZeUq